"David didn’t even get into our youth team the year we won the FA Youth Cup until the semi-final. It’s a growing thing. Paul Scholes was just a small lad, but he sprouted up to 5ft 8in, the height he is now. "Scott was a skelf of a boy, then he sprouted when he became an apprentice. "In fact, he was playing centre-forward for the youth team.They lost Ashley Fletcher to West Ham and Marcus Rashford wasn’t getting into the team at the time because he was also growing. ‘So they played McTominay at centre-forward quite a lot, but he obviously developed into a midfield player. It’s possible he grew ten inches in a year."McTominay has certainly developed into a player with the necessary physicality to play in the Premier League. At the moment, that is where the Beckham comparisons end; not to demean McTominay, but very few players have the natural talent of Beckham.
